Abstract

Based on the reported glycosidase inhibitory activities of 1,6-dideoxy-1,6-imino-L-iditol, the corresponding aryl glycosides 4-nitrophenyl alpha- and beta-L -idoseptano side 7 and 8 were synthesised as possible glycosidase substrates. Despite their inherently larger size, these septanosides were indeed shown to be glycosidase substrates, albeit weak ones. In addition, these two substrate analogues 7 and 8 also demonstrated a remarkable degree of selectivity for beta- and alpha-glucosidases, respectively. (c) 2005 Elsevier Ltd. All rights reserved.
